Output 16c8d0494fb65b69f182eefb5d57c94cd532535949567643a8f76e5d81a60d0b:1

value
66511473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c076e8a4b11e9a850547967da84f1a3a6d4319ce OP_EQUAL
address
MRSpRBpQdBShBcjaQZjPAWNTMBFxTamQQz
transaction
16c8d0494fb65b69f182eefb5d57c94cd532535949567643a8f76e5d81a60d0b
spent
true